Martin Luther King Jr. believed in the equality principle of the Declaration of Independence. So did Lincoln, Frederick Douglas and the American founders. Do most American’s still believe – or even understand it today? In this episode, Ben explains why all Americans should be proud of the ideas their country was founded on and how Martin Luther King helped further actualize the truths in America’s mission statement.
